Job Description
You will be a key contributor on cross-functional development teams
that will be creating innovative & cost-effective concentrating
photovoltaic (CPV) products. You will investigate numerous mechanical
manufacturing technologies, perform experiments, create cost models,
and implement your ideas into volume production. You will work directly
with the engineering & operations teams to influence the product
design and manufacturing approach. Areas of investigation will include
but not be limited to: metal fabrication techniques, metal joining techniques
& advanced assembly technologies. Responsibilities
to include:
• Investigate mechanical manufacturing technologies for fabrication
& assembly
• Develop & implement test methodologies to evaluate competing
technologies. Prepare & present reports to summarize & communicate
test results.
• Develop cost models for manufacturing options & provide
objective criteria for decision making
• Implement selected technologies in volume production
